Hello, I hope that someone can give me some guidance. I am very new to guitar. I know 5 chords and am working on changing from one to the next. Right now, I place one finger at a time on each string. I don't think that is the way to keep going. Will I just learn the shape automatically over time or is there a method for learning the whole chord at once that I need to employ?[br][br]Many thanks.

Check out this lesson! https://www.guitartricks.com/lesson.php?input=23483&s_id=1932

It takes time, but eventually you will have the muscle memory in your fingers to create the entire chord shape in one motion. I believe in you, you will be able to do it!
